Javafree
Página Inicial do Fórum > Java Avançado

Quebra de linhas ao gerar um arquivo.txt com formatter



Criar novo tópico   Responder tópico


  1. Sorentaken
    Posts:1


    Comment Arrow

    Publicado em: 18/09/2016 20:12:45

    Ola , estou com duvida sobre quebra de linha utilizando o FORMATTER para criar textos.

    Atualmente meu codigo é esse

    package Main;

    import java.io.FileNotFoundException;
    import java.lang.SecurityException;
    import java.util.Formatter;
    import java.util.FormatterClosedException;
    import java.util.NoSuchElementException;
    import java.util.Scanner;

    public class GerarArquivoTexto
    {
    private Formatter saida;

    public void abrirArquivo()
    {
    try
    {
    saida = new Formatter( "Criptografado.txt" );
    }
    catch ( SecurityException excecao )
    {
    System.err.println(
    "Você não tem permissão de gravação para este arquivo." );
    System.exit( 1 );
    }
    catch ( FileNotFoundException excecao )
    {
    System.err.println( "Erro ao criar arquivo." );
    System.exit( 1 );
    }
    }

    public void adicionarRegistros(String a , String b)
    {

    Scanner entrada = new Scanner( System.in );



    try
    {

    saida.format("%s\n%s",a,b);
    System.getProperty("line.separator";
    }
    catch ( FormatterClosedException excecao )
    {
    System.err.println( "Erro ao gravar arquivo." );
    return;
    }

    catch ( NoSuchElementException excecao )
    {
    System.err.println( "Entrada inválida. Por favor, tente de novo." );
    entrada.nextLine();
    }

    }

    public void fecharArquivo()
    {
    if ( saida != null )
    saida.close();
    }
    }


    Se alguem souber como realizar a quebra durante a criação do arquivo texto por favor ajudar



  1. Relacionados